Island Hopping in Greece: Mykonos, Crete, and SantoriniUncovering the Secrets of Machu PicchuThe Best Museum Tours in EuropeThe Fascinating History of IstanbulSafari in South Africa: Spotting the Big FiveTasting Wine in Napa ValleyA Journey Through Budapest: Exploring Hungary's Historic CapitalGet Lost in the Beauty of Santorini's White-Washed VillagesThe Best of Wine Country: California's Napa ValleyThe Stunning Beaches of Phuket, Thailand 3 days in tokyo petra night tours bhutan tourism Cairo travel places to visit in colombia riding donkeys santorini hanoi itinerary havana travel best hawaii island to visit best places to visit in south africa